Art Elective Project Reflection

Please answer the questions below. Do not delete the prompts!



  1. Describe your project

For my project, I created abstract art by melting crayons with a heat gun onto cardstock.


  1. What knowledge did you already have about the project before you started?
    I didn’t have much experience or knowledge about this project besides that I had a general idea what melting crayons would look like.


  2. What new skill did you want to learn coming into the project?
    I wanted to create something that isn’t perfect, something that doesn’t have to be completed in a certain way or it won’t look right. I wanted to learn how to work without being such a perfectionist.


  3. Did you accomplish this goal?
    I did accomplish this goal, although it was hard at times.


  4. How do you know you accomplished the goal? If you didn’t accomplish the goal, why do you think that is?
    I know I accomplished this goal because there were a few occasions when things didn’t turn out how I planned and I wanted to give up. However, I kept going until I completed my project and I was happy with my results.


  5. What other skill(s) did you learn along the way?
    I learned how to work a heat gun properly along the way.


  6. What are you most proud of in this project?
    I am most proud of the creativity and individuality in my project. I am also proud that it isn’t precise and clean cut like my other projects usually are.


  7. What would you do differently if you had to do the project over again?

If I had to do the project over again, I would plan out a color scheme for my crayons so that all the colors are complementary and flow together nicely.
